1. When discovering a vehicle behind wanting to overtake while driving, the driver should _______.

A. Maintain the original speed

B. Reduce speed, observe and run by the right side to yield

C. Speed up and go ahead by the right side

D. Not yield

Answer: B

2. When overtaking a vehicle stopping on the right side, the driver should ________ in case that vehicle starts up suddenly or opens the door.

A. Speed up and pass

B. Keep honking

C. Maintain the normal speed

D. Keep a safe horizontal distance from that vehicle, reduce speed and pass

Answer: D

3. If a motorized vehicle driver drives on the road after getting drunk is subject to a prison term of more than 3 years.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

6. When driving at night, the drivers observation ability is visibly poorer and his visibility range becomes shorter than driving in the daytime.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

7. How to use lights when overtaking at night?

A. turn off the high beam light

B. turn on high beam lights

C. use fog lights

D. using the high and low beam lights alternately

Answer: D

10. The driver who chases and races while driving on the road, and commits serious acts is subject to ______

A. a prison term of 6 months

B. a prison term of more than 1 year

C. a criminal restriction and a fine

D. a criminal detention and a fine

Answer: D

11. A vehicle may stop on the ramp of an expressway.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

12. When driving at night, the drivers visibility range becomes shorter and his observation becomes poorer. At the same time, the driver can easily become tired because he has to highly concentrate his attention.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

13. This sign reminds the lane or the road narrows on both sides ahead.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

14. If a driver has driven a motorized vehicle for more than four hours running, he should stop the vehicle and rest for at least ____________.

A. 10 minutes

B. 15 minutes

C. 20 minutes

D. 5 minutes

Answer: C

20. When a vehicle enters a two-way tunnel, the driver should turn on ________.

A. The hazard lights

B. The high beam light

C. The fog light

D. The width light or the low beam light

Answer: D
